2022 Medicare Part B Standard Premium, Deductible, and IRMAAs for Parts B and D

The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id (CMS) have announced the below for 2022:

  • The standard Part B Premium is increasing by $21.60/month to $170.10 in 2022 (up from $148.50 in 2021)
  • The Income Related Monthly Adjustment Amounts (IRMAAs) for Parts B and D are increasing as shown below, for those with incomes greater than $91k individual or $182k joint
  • For purposes of calculating, the Modified Adjusted Gross Income (MAGI) from 2 years prior (2020’s tax return, for 2022) is used
  • The Part B deductible is increasing by $30/year to $233 in 2022 (up from $203 in 2021)
